Request A Quote

    Contact us for free consultation today


    We are here to help and serve your business. Please contact us if you have questions or need a quote for your next project. One of our advisor will reach out to you to discuss your business needs.

    Contact us:

    Toll Free: 1-800-517-5253

    Phone: 917-775-7047

    e-mail: [email protected]

    Email: [email protected]

    Address: 23-03 27th street, Astoria, NY 11105

    We will get back to you within 1 Business day

    We make your renewable energy project more bankable!